Halle has lived her whole life surrounded by hay bails and horses. Growing up surrounded by horses, in Wisconsin, has taught Halle two things. 1) Always have more go than woah, and 2) You don't need a boyfriend to make you happy, eventually you will always come back to the stables. Ethan has lives his whole life living in the big apple of the U.K., London. He had always enjoyed staying indoors, playing, and filming video games and challenge videos with his mates for a Youtube channel they all run together. Which they are better known as the Sidemen. One day, for a Sidemen video, all the boys had to spin a roulette wheel to determine what new skill they will learn professionally. When Ethan spins "barrel racing", he lands himself in Wisconsin, taking lessons from the world champion herself. He quickly falls in love with his instructor, but she doesn't feel the same way.
